How they compare

Faroe Islands currently reports 0.9856 m3 per person against 0.4295 m3 per person in American Samoa, a difference of 0.5561 m3 per person.

That makes Faroe Islands's figure about 2.3 times American Samoa's.

Across all 33 years both countries report, Faroe Islands has been ahead every year.

American Samoa ranks 3rd and Faroe Islands ranks 1st of 184 countries.

Faroe Islands has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ade American Samoa Faroe Islands Difference Ahead
1990s 0.0095 m3 per person 0.1066 m3 per person 0.0971 m3 per person Faroe Islands
2000s 0.0113 m3 per person 0.0729 m3 per person 0.0616 m3 per person Faroe Islands
2010s 0.092 m3 per person 0.3053 m3 per person 0.2133 m3 per person Faroe Islands
2020s 0.1973 m3 per person 0.6067 m3 per person 0.4094 m3 per person Faroe Islands

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
